Abstract
The invention relates to a multistage combined type diamond circular saw blade, which comprises a plurality of diamond circular saw blade substrates with different diameters, wherein the diamond circular saw blade substrates are arranged on an installing shaft and a fixed flange plate according to external diameter standards in descending order or in ascending order; sawteeth are arranged on the outer ends of the diamond circular saw blade substrates; and diamond knob blocks are welded on the sawteeth of the diamond circular saw blade substrates. Compared with the existing single combined, double-combined or tri-combined saw blade, according to the multistage combined type diamond circular saw blade, multiple groups of saw blades can be operated simultaneously, the raw materials outturn percentage can be further improved, the power consumption is saved, and the cutting efficiency and the board accuracy are improved.

Background technology
Diamond disc has been widely used in the cutting processing of nonmetallic materials such as stone material, cement, glass, ceramic, and diamond disc is made up of diamond segment and saw bit matrix.
The combination diamond disc is meant that the saw blade of multi-disc same specification or two or more specifications is assemblied in a kind of instrument of cuts sheet material of being used on the main shaft of same saw; Be mainly used in cutting granite and marble slab village in groups; Improve waste material volume recovery; And the saving power consumption, improve cutting efficiency and sheet material precision.Thin sheet material and crudy are good because combination saw can process, and cutting-rate is high, thereby at home and abroad by extensive employing.
Widely used in the market combination diamond disc mainly contains single combination (same specification), two combinations (two kinds of specifications), three combination types such as (three kinds of specifications).

The specific embodiment
Find out that by accompanying drawing 1,2 the present invention is made up of diamond circular saw film base body 1, installation shaft and fixed flange 2, diamond segment 3 and the diamond circular saw film base body sawtooth 4 of multiple different size from big to small.Diamond circular saw film base body 1 is according on the descending or ascending installation shaft and fixed flange 2 that is installed to saw of external diameter specification, and diamond circular saw film base body 1 outer end offers sawtooth 4, and diamond block 3 is welded on the diamond circular saw film base body 1.
The material of every diamond circular saw film base body 1, interior hole dimension and thickness are identical, sawtooth 4 same length of outer rounded ends.Other as saw bit matrix hardness, flatness, end jump, parameter such as footpath jumping, internal stress distribution and performance indications are consistent.
After diamond segment 3 is gone up in diamond saw blade substrate 1 welding, be installed on the saw, guarantee that through installation shaft and fixed flange 2 distance between each saw blade is identical according to the external diameter specification is descending or ascending.
The external diameter of diamond circular saw film base body 1 meets the following conditions: D representes the most large stretch of; H representes the height of cutting stone material plate; N representes tricks, and the specification of then corresponding diamond circular saw film base body is second: D-2h/n, the 3rd: D-4h/n, the 4th: D-6h/n, the 5th: D-8h/n, the 6th: D-10h/n, the rest may be inferred.The combo general formula is:
D=D-2 (i-1) h/n, i=1 wherein, 2,3,4,5,6 ...
With six saw bit matrixes is example:
The most large stretch of saw bit matrix external diameter is D=1650mm, and during the height h=630mm of cutting stone material plate, each sized saw bit matrix external diameter is respectively: D
1=1650mm, D
2=1440mm, D
3=1230mm, D
4=1020mm, D
5=810mm, D
6=600mm.
